Fungi can contain a variety of enzymes, such as protease, amylase, lipase, cellulase and tilactase (supports lactose absorption). Like plant enzymes, fungal enzymes are acid stable and can survive within the pH range of the stomach. They are also suitable for a vegetarian diet, unlike animal-sourced enzymes.

Moisture-proof paint slurry and preparation method thereof

Provided are moisture-proof paint slurry and a preparation method thereof. The moisture-proof paint slurry is prepared from, by weight, 30-40 parts of refined raw lacquer, 25-35 parts of mica powder, 20-25 parts of gypsum powder, 15-22 parts of kaolin powder, 5-12 parts of cattle bone powder, 10-15 parts of moisture proof agent and 8-12 parts of adhesive; preparation of the moisture-proof paint slurry comprises the following processes of 1 mixed powder preparation, 2 moisture proof agent preparation and 3 mixing. According to the moisture-proof paint slurry and the preparation method thereof, the raw lacquer is refined with a fungal enzyme, the rheological property can be effectively adjusted, the produced paint slurry is high in adhesive force and hardness and has the functions of resisting corrosion, resisting abrasion and preventing moisture, the paint slurry is smeared to a wood base, coating is convenient, the hardness and strength of the wood base can be effectively improved, holes and gaps in a board can be well filled up and smoothed, a layer of protective film can be formed on the surface layer of the board, the effective moisture-proof function is achieved, the quality of a bottom plate is improved, and therefore the quality of a finished lacquer painting product is guaranteed.

Fungal enzyme for improving content of gasifiable oil in crude oil as well as preparation method and application method thereof

The invention discloses a fungal enzyme for improving the content of gasifiable oil in crude oil as well as a preparation method and an application method thereof. The fungal enzyme is prepared from the following raw materials: an oil displacement fungus and an enzyme-production culture medium, wherein the enzyme-production culture medium is prepared from wheat bran, a salt solution and the crudeoil. The fungal enzyme disclosed by the invention is used for carrying out enzymatic conversion on the crude oil and a macromolecular component including asphalt in the crude oil is degraded and converted into a small molecular gasifiable component; the content of saturated hydrocarbon and aromatic hydrocarbon in an enzymatic conversion product of the crude oil is remarkably improved; the preparation method is simple and easy to operate and implement; and the fungal enzyme can provide theoretical support for improving the quality of the crude oil by utilizing the fungal enzyme and also provides scientific evidence for a technological deign for improving the yield of gasoline and low-boiling-point coal diesel in a refining process of the crude oil by utilizing a fungal enzyme method.

Isomaltose hypgather cleaning and production method

The invention belongs to the technical field of starch sugar and especially relates to an isomaltose hypgather cleaning and production method. The isomaltose hypgather cleaning and production method comprises the following steps: using peeled and degermed corn flour as a raw material, dissolving the corn flour by adding water, adding alpha-amylase in the dissolved solution, and adjusting pH value and keeping warm; cooling the dissolved solution and adding fungal enzyme for thermal insulation, adding alpha-transglucosidase and keeping warm, adjusting pH to neutral, and adding neutral protease to carry out enzymolysis so as to obtain an enzymatic hydrolysate; filtering, decolouring and refining the enzymatic hydrolysate and finally concentrating to obtain a concentrate; separating the concentrate by a sequential simulated moving bed, respectively collecting effluents of isomaltose hypgather, glucose and polysaccharide, concentrating the isomaltose hypgather eluant, and drying to obtain the product. The method provided by the invention has advantages of simple step and stable reaction, is easy to carry out, is adopted to effectively raise production efficiency and utilization rate of raw materials, reduce energy consumption and production cost and mitigate environmental burden, and is beneficial to industrial production.
